
Three Bedroom holiday home
📐 181 m²
San Juan River House is situated in Pagosa Springs. The accommodation is 30 km from the Wolf Creek Ski Resort and has free WiFi throughout the property.

✓ It was a great home for our group. Very clean and functional for our purposes. Great location! The river was awesome.
✓ location was great
✗ lights in bedroom didn’t work